Does Vietnam have an electric car market?

Amid the global decarbonization trend, Vietnam is also promoting the adoption of electric vehicles (EVs), with sales growing rapidly in recent years. The EV share of passenger car sales ranks second in Asia after China, surpassing Thailand. A key characteristic of Vietnam's EV market is its leadership by domestic brands.

What makes Vietnam's EV market unique?

A key characteristic of Vietnam's EV market is its leadership by domestic brands. This structure differs from other major Southeast Asian countries where Chinese brands are the driving force. According to the International Energy Agency (IEA), Vietnam's passenger vehicle battery electric vehicle (BEV) sales have expanded rapidly in recent years.
